To answer the last part of your question...

I don't care what you drive to stop by for a sales call. I might just give you more "cred" if you drove something other then a P/U - in other words, It would show that you can "think outside the box" and value substance over style. ( and don't need to be like everyone else)

Example: The last tractor I bought, the sales guy came out in a Buick Regal, I bought the tractor. - he told me for the ride / MPG's and comfort, it was way better then any P/U.

The last sales guy that came over, drove a 2500 Chevy. I did not buy from him...It had absolutly nothing to do with what he drove!

Now if you need a truck to deliver seed, go into fields, that is another story, it would make no sence to own both car / truck.

Just my thoughts.....
